After months of teasing on social media, magician Chris Ramsay has finally released his very own deck of playing cards.
Inspired by Memento Mori, where imagery of a skull represents the short-lived nature of all things material and a reminder of our mortality. As such, the Memento Mori deck features a unique low-poly design skull on the tuck and the card backs. According to Chris,
The low-poly design for me represents a simplistic one. The bare “bones” of 3D creation and graphic art, the first steps of animation or as I see it, the beginning of (virtual) life.
From the promo images, the Ace, Joker and courts are very stylized and modern-looking, consistent with the theme of the deck. The unique design and eye-catching colours will enhance displays and card flourishes making fans, spreads and cascades look amazing.
